Hive
/haɪv/
noun
1. A teeming multitude
synonym:
- hive
2. A man-made receptacle that houses a swarm of bees
synonym:
- beehive,
- hive
3. A structure that provides a natural habitation for bees
- As in a hollow tree
synonym:
- beehive,
- hive
verb
1. Store, like bees
- "Bees hive honey and pollen"
- "He hived lots of information"
synonym:
- hive
2. Move together in a hive or as if in a hive
- "The bee swarms are hiving"
synonym:
- hive
3. Gather into a hive
- "The beekeeper hived the swarm"
synonym:
- hive
